    Navigating PA School with a Low GPA: Sara Matthews' Journey and Advice

    In this interview, Sara Matthews, a recently graduated, board-certified PA working in OBGYN and urogynecology, shares her journey from overcoming a low GPA and gaining patient care experience for PA school applications. Despite facing challenges with her grades, Sara’s perseverance and focus on improving her patient care experience paid off, leading to her acceptance into PA school at Lincoln Memorial University.

    Becoming a PA: Insights, Challenges, and Encouragements

    Watch my interview with dermatology PA, Amanda Lark, PA-C. Amanda shares her journey into the PA profession, the challenges she faced, and insights for aspiring PAs. Her story emphasizes the importance of persistence, strategic planning, and making the most of each opportunity. Amanda's experience working in various medical fields, including emergency, urgent care, and dermatology, illustrates the diverse paths available within the PA profession. She also discusses work-life balance, career decisions, and the evolving landscape of dermatology, providing valuable advice for those looking to pursue a career in this field.

    First Day on the Job as a New PA: Real Talk and Advice You may know today's Pre-PA Club guest from her Tiktok @lyssllo, or Alyssa Lloret, PA-C! We discuss the transition from PA school to starting a new job as a physician assistant in the real world. Alyssa shares her experience of taking a gap year, the application process for PA school, and ultimately landing a job in an ENT department. She highlights the importance of remaining open-minded about specializations, the usefulness of gap years to gain healthcare experience, and the value of being proactive in job searching early.

    Navigating PA School Applications: Interviews, Essays, and Insights

    On today's podcast episode I am interviewing PA Platform coach, Peter Alfano, PA-C. We dive into the intricacies of preparing focusing on essays and interviews. Through discussing various essay styles and offering live editing advice, we underline the importance of personalizing essays to showcase applicants' journey to wanting to become a PA.

    We discuss avoiding common errors such as being too casual or failing to specify why one wants to be a PA. Peter gives tips on interview preparation, stressing the necessity of expressing genuine interest in the PA profession, detailing personal experiences, and tailoring responses to demonstrate a deep understanding of the PA role.

    Additionally, he gives advice for re-applicants on enhancing their applications and interviews based on feedback. Throughout, the importance of authenticity, thorough preparation, and understanding the unique aspects of the PA profession is highlighted.

    Financial Planning and Investing for Physician Assistants

    In this podcast episode, Savanna Perry welcomes guest Kristin Burton, a practicing PA and founder of Strive with Kristin teaching medical professionals how to manage personal finances. They discuss the importance of financial planning and investing for both future and practicing PAs. They delve into the dangers of accumulating substantial student loan debt without a plan for repayment and stress the significance of investing in retirement plans early in one's career. Strategies for wealth building and retiring early are further explored. The episode contains various resources for listeners to learn more about personal finances.

    Pre-PA Club Podcast Interview: Joy Moverly Discusses the Joint PA and Public Health Degree Program at Touro University California Joint MSPAS-MPH Program

    In this episode of the Pre PA Club Podcast, host Savanna Perry is in conversation with Joy Moverly, the program director of Touro University California Joint MSPAS-MPH Program in Vallejo, CA. They delve into the unique offerings of the university's physician assistant (PA) program and its inclusivity towards all students. Besides offering public health field study opportunities in areas like criminal justice, community health, and global health, Touro stands out for its joint PA and public health degree program. The institution also uniquely equips all its students as lifestyle coaches via the Diabetes Prevention Program. On the flip side, Joy, as a practicing PA, talks about her own journey from aspiring to be a physical therapist to becoming a passionate advocate for diabetes education. She also discusses the value of self-reflection for PA students during their application process and interview phase. Savanna ends by probing into Joy's thoughts on the future of PA education.
